PROJECT DESCRIPTION :
Our group recently identified a new class of mammalian non-coding RNA genes, termed lncRNAs with important roles in human biology and disease. These lncRNAs exert their regulatory influence on the genome in uncharacterized ways. We are looking for a highly motivated individual to join our integrative computational and experimental team to help develop and implement computational methods to analyze and integrate various high throughput datasets. Specifically, the candidate will develop methods for computational analysis of various types of high-throughput datasets to probe the function and mechanism of lncRNAs. This will include algorithms to analyze and integrate data from lncRNA-protein, lncRNA- DNA , and genetic perturbation data.
